After word hit the internet that the Lollapalooza lineup would serve as the hallowed ground where Black Sabbath would play their one and only American date, the festival confirmed the rumors to be true earlier today.

Along with Sabbath headlining the Chicago festival, the rest of the rumored lineup was officially posted on Lollapalooza's website. Bands including Red Hot Chili Peppers, the Black Keys, Jack White, the Shins, Florence + the Machine, Passion Pit and the newly reunited At the Drive-In are set to play the three-day fest. The most interesting element of this year's Lollapalooza lineup is the fact that this will be the first time Ozzy Osbourne has been welcomed to play. His initial rejection from Lollapalooza back in the '90s -- because Ozzy wasn't "cool enough" according to Sharon Osbourne -- will now be rectified as the "Prince of F---ing Darkness" will now step onto a Lollapalooza stage.
